Chapter 180 Not the same place, but the same time

Chapter 180 Not the same place, but the same time

what is that?
For a moment, Jincolini didn't realize what this guy was thinking.

Jincolini fell into deep thought as he watched the green MA's side gun sweep past, fire the missile into the air, and then stay in place to accumulate energy.

MA-spec weapons are indeed superior to those of ordinary MS and can threaten battleships.

But the current range should be far from enough.

"Ignore him, aim and fire!"

In an environment with high concentration of Minovsky particles, the calibration of naval guns often takes a long time.

During this period of time, the muzzle of the MA gradually lit up, and a structure could be seen rotating at high speed.

After estimating the caliber of the gun barrel and the armor of the Birmingham class, Jincolini finally concluded that this shot could be withstanded.

What's more, as the flagship, the Birmingham class is in the middle of this formation, making it difficult to execute forced dodge.

"Electric needle launch!"

The six GM modified tanks fired their electric needles at the same time, and at the same time, Birmingham's main guns also fired!
The thick pink stream of light hit Luwei Jielu's chest directly!
However, Val Vallo immediately rushed in front of Luviteru and blocked the six electric needles with the heavy shield.

The thick shield prevented the six electric needles from penetrating only into the surface armor of the shield. At the same time, the discharge system of the electric needles, which was specifically used to destroy the equipment, was also blocked by the special insulation layer of the shield.

Immediately afterwards, Val Vallo dived down, giving way to Luvi Jello!
The I force field was immediately deployed, also dissolving the beam of light.

This situation was expected.

Since he had no intention of scoring in one go, Jincolini naturally wouldn't take it too seriously.

"Prepare for the second round..."

"Enemy MA, high energy reaction!"

The muzzle of the green MA began to drag a yellow light - it was as if time had slowed down!
I heard the CIC's shout, "...Energy readings, it's a nuclear bomb!"

Everyone on the bridge looked in disbelief.

The reason why the fleet was deployed in the form of a square formation was because the idea was just like the two thousand battleships in the Trisolaran war, that "there will be no more military achievements after this battle." It was almost like a fleet review that was interrupted by the remnants of Zeon, but now it was used to show off the Federation's military power to the Earth Sphere.

But it is precisely this formation that means that this nuclear bomb, which is beyond everyone's expectations, will cause maximum damage!
"This is not Solomon's airspace, but I can hear the echoes of Solomon's soldiers howling..."

Daryl muttered in a low voice.

"Solomon, I will return"

"The fleet retreats—"

The captain of the Birmingham class stood up from his seat and shouted to the communicator.

Jin Kelini no longer cares about the other party's overstepping of authority.

"Is it still too late?"

Jincolini turned his head and looked out the porthole at the approaching nuclear bomb, which was getting closer and closer and appeared to be in the shape of a light beam due to the laser ignition and detonation.

"Rebil...what will the Federation become after this?"

I even saw some people on the bridge leave their seats in fear, trying to escape from this place that would be hit directly by a nuclear bomb.

Jincolini simply turned his gaze towards the direction of Jinmi Island, his eyes revealing unspeakable emotions.

Everything is lonely.

The battleship charred and twisted in the void, losing its function and becoming scrap metal floating in the void.

How many lives were lost in this instant?

Kelly couldn't imagine it.

There was absolutely no sense of having taken someone else's life.

Sitting in such a large machine, even if you kill someone, there will be no blood splattering within your sight.

His left arm was shaking, and Kelly couldn't help but loosen his right hand that was holding the joystick and pressed it on his left arm that was connected to the body. The regeneration P system was a gift from Cardo that allowed him to return to the battlefield.

But after he successfully repaired Val Vallo, he didn't even get to see Cardo for the last time, as the latter died on the battlefield inexplicably.

Logically, Kelly should be grateful to Cardo, but now he is trembling.

I don't know if it was using the shield to protect the two people and resist the vibration caused by the impact of the nuclear bomb, or if it was afraid of this feeling.
"So clear! This light is the shining spirit of the Zeon soldiers!"

The voice of the current commander of the Stardust combat front was heard during the communication.

"Federation, Solomon, can you see I have returned!"

This guy named Daryl clearly has no combat record at Fort Solomon on his resume.

Kelly actually felt a little panic in his heart.

Recently, there have been some bad rumors circulating in the Diraz fleet, saying that Daryl was possessed by the dead Cardo and so on.

Could it be that the end of Zeon remnants like them will be like this, haunted by resentment and losing themselves?

It was not known whether it was a psychological effect or something else, but Kelly seemed to see out of the corner of his eye a scarlet flag with a black cross and a golden emblem flying in the background of Luvi Jello.

That is the flag of Zeon.

I originally thought that it was the ghost of Cardo that haunted this guy, but from this perspective, should I say it is the ghost of Zeon?

Kelly gritted his teeth internally.

In that case, he himself was also haunted by the Zeon ghosts, and so was the entire Delaz fleet!

The tremors stopped.

Electricity was also escaping from the joints of Val Vallo's left arm, apparently due to overload.

The shield expelled a large cloud of exhaust gas, and judging from the edges that had already turned red and hot, this shield, which was hastily made using battleship armor, still performed at its basic function.

"click"

There was a mechanical sound, and the shield, whose surface was charred black but the Zeon logo was still faintly visible, was thrown away.

"Thank you for your hard work. This gift from Axis looks bigger than you thought."

Daryl said to Kelly in a slightly hoarse voice.

This nuclear bomb was specially adjusted by Axis and shipped to the Diraz fleet.

It was expected that being able to destroy one-third of the fleet at the naval review would be a feat, but now, due to the arrogance of the Federation, this nuclear bomb successfully accomplished this feat.

The remaining remnants, as well as many ships that have suffered electronic equipment failures due to radiation, will be handed over to the follow-up personnel of the Diraz fleet.

It was equivalent to the second phase of Operation Stardust, which greatly weakened the Federation's military strength.

"Well done, you two. Now we can start our return voyage."

When Luwei Jielu was about to throw away the useless gun barrel, Diraz's communication came in.

"As soon as he saw that most of the Federation's ships had sunk, Sima rushed over here. It's all thanks to you guys."

Diraz sighed.

Although I don't like Sima, she is from Zeon after all, so at this juncture I should let her fight first.

"To be on the safe side, the two of you quickly go to the tail end of the colony satellite and kill the haunting Onder-Tek. After all, this is a Gundam, so I'm really looking forward to your coming to fight."

Diraz said this calmly, not getting excited about his exceptional performance.

Kelly nodded, but glanced at Lu Wei Jie Lu when he turned around.

According to the maintenance team, Daryl has never left the machine since he boarded the Luvi-Jero, and he eats, drinks, defecates and urinates inside the machine.

It was as if it was swallowed by the body.
